Hi guys,

Just wanting some initial info about transplanting a short block chevy engine into the 924 engine bay. I have looked at the info about 944 transplants on the renegade hybrids site and have two main questions:

1) Are the engine mounts on the 924 the same as the 944? If not, is it easy to fabricate your own mounts given a degree of welding skill?

2) What is the current solution for mating the chev output shaft to the torque tube assy?
